风沙环境下钢结构涂层低角度冲蚀特性研究   总被引:7,自引:3,他引:4  
郝贠洪  李永 《摩擦学学报》2013,33(4):343-347
针对风沙环境中钢结构涂层长期受冲蚀,涂层破坏直接降低钢结构体系耐久性的现状,采用能模拟风沙环境的气流挟沙喷射法对钢结构涂层试件进行了低角度冲蚀试验,用失重测量法测定涂层冲蚀失重量与沙剂量和冲击速度关系,进而评定冲蚀程度,用扫描电镜(SEM)观测分析涂层冲蚀区的微观形貌来分析冲蚀机理,并提出了涂层冲蚀程度评价计算公式.结果表明:涂层冲蚀失重量随沙剂量和冲击速度的增大而增加;低角度冲蚀主要为微切削作用,材料硬度起决定因素,高角度冲蚀主要为冲蚀挤压变形作用,材料韧性起决定作用,由于涂层材料硬度低而韧性高,故在低冲角下其受冲蚀程度严重;验证了评价计算公式用于评价涂层冲蚀程度的可靠性.研究结果将为准确评价风沙区钢结构体系耐久性提供依据.  相似文献

Total Diet Studies on pesticide residues in foods carried out in Italy in the last two decades are briefly summarized and data are discussed. Health risk assessment is expressed by the ratio total intake/ADI (%ADI ingested) for each compound and by the sum of the percentages of ADI for each compound within the same class of pesticides.

The total dietary intake of chlorinated pesticides, that was almost 100% of ADI in the years 1970-74, decreased down to 10% in the period 1978-84. This trend was confirmed for DDT in recent years, while data on Lindane and Heptachlor seem to be constant.

As regards the organophosphorus pesticides the sum of the percentages of ADI ingested for each compound, extrapolated from recent data (1990-1991) is about 20% and can be regarded as reasonably acceptable because the study included practically all the mainly used compounds.

Only few data are available for some pesticides like dithiocarbamates, especially EBDCs and their derivatives (e.g. ETU), other carbamates (e.g. aldicarb), paraquat etc. Moreover, analytical methods for these compounds should be improved.

The need for a considerable improvement in the number and organization of monitoring structures, in the use of standardized analytical procedures, in good laboratory practice standards and in the realibility of “monitoring protocols” and their homogeneity is evidenced.  相似文献

The total and bioaccessible concentration of 16 polycyclic aromatic hydrocarbons (PAHs) in soil from a former industrial site was investigated. Typical total concentrations across the sampling sites ranged from 1.5 mg kg−1 for acenaphthylene up to 243 mg kg−1 for fluoranthene. The oral bioaccessibility of PAHs in soil was assessed using an in vitro gastrointestinal extraction (Fed Organic Estimation human Simulation Test, FOREhST method). The oral bioaccessibility data indicated that fluorene, phenanthrene, chrysene, indeno(1,2,3-cd)pyrene and dibenzo(a,h)anthracene had the highest % bioaccessible fraction (based on their upper 75th percentile values being >60%) while the other PAHs had lower % bioaccessible fractions (means ranging between 35 and 59%). Significantly lower bioaccessibilities were determined for naphthalene. With respect to method validation and inter-laboratory comparison, the total and bioaccessible concentrations of benzo(a)anthracene, benzo(b)anthracene, benzo(k)fluoranthene, benzo(a)pyrene, indeno(1,2,3-cd)pyrene and dibenzo(a,h)anthracene was compared to published data derived using the same samples. The total PAH concentrations at the site were compared with generic assessment criteria (GAC) using the residential land use scenario (with plant uptake at 6% soil organic matter). Concentrations of 7 of the PAHs investigated within the soils could lead to an unacceptable risk to human health at this site.  相似文献

模糊综合评判法在台州市地表水评价中的应用   总被引:1,自引:0,他引:1  
应用模糊综合评判法,以长潭等9个水库为研究对象,对台州地区水质进行厂评价:结果表明,台州地区总体水质较好,除东湖属Ⅳ类水外,其它全为Ⅲ类,适合人们生存及生产需要。根据评价提出了相心的建议  相似文献

Structure-activity relationship (SAR) and quantitative structure-activity relationship (QSAR), collec- tively referred to as (Q)SARs, play an important role in ecological risk assessment (ERA) of organic chemicals. (Q)SARs can fill the data gap for physical-chemical, environmental behavioral and ecotoxicological parameters of organic compounds; they can decrease experimental expenses and reduce the extent of experimental testing (especially animal testing); they can also be used to assess the uncertainty of the experimental data. With the development for several decades, (Q)SARs in envi- ronmental sciences show three features: application orientation, multidisciplinary integration, and in- telligence. Progress of (Q)SAR technology for ERA of toxic organic compounds, including endpoint selection and mathematic methods for establishing simple, transparent, easily interpretable and portable (Q)SAR models, is reviewed. The recent development on defining application domains and diagnosing outliers is summarized. Model characterization with respect to goodness-of-fit, stability and predictive power is specially presented. The purpose of the review is to promote the development of (Q)SARs orientated to ERA of organic chemicals.  相似文献

Borut Smodiš 《Mikrochimica acta》1996,123(1-4):303-309
Neutron activation analysis is one of the analytical techniques often used for certification of reference materials. The k0-based method of instrumental neutron activation analysis can also be applied in intercomparison runs in the certification process and therefore it is desirable to know its accuracy in advance. Possible systematic errors related to the application of nuclear data at given neutron flux rate parameters, that can affect the uncertainties of the results obtained by this specific method, are elucidated and error propagation factors calculated for a typical irradiation position in the TRIGA Mark II reactor of the Jozef Stefan Institute. It was found that these uncertainties are at the level of 1–2% on the average.  相似文献

技术商品定价模型的研究初探   总被引:2,自引:0,他引:2  
本文通过现有的几类技术商品定价模型,指出了现行的技术商品定价方法存在的问题,然后分别建立转让方定价模型和受让方定价模型进行研究。本文以不同的模型形式指出了作为转让方的科研单位和生产企业其不同的定价思路,同时对模糊综合评判应用于作价中预期利润率的确定进行了积极的探索,并尝试在受让方定价模型中运用风险模拟来体现技术商品使用的风险特征。  相似文献

啤酒废水生物处理工艺综合评价   总被引:1,自引:0,他引:1  
在深入探索、研究我国啤酒废水的各种处理工艺的基础上 ,对五种具有代表性的、相对较为成熟的生物处理工艺进行分析和比较 ,并提出了综合评价治理设施的评价因素集、评价指标和评价方法。为啤酒废水治理的工艺选择提供了科学依据。  相似文献

A structural health assessment (SHA) methodology is developed using data acquired from structural health monitoring (SHM) system installed on long-span bridges. A set of fatigue criteria has been proposed for pre-determining the global state of the bridge structure failure due to fatigue. This involves finding the threshold of fatigue initiation, below which the rate of fatigue damage may be undetectable under current technology or it is economically unfeasible. The state-of-art for large structures corresponds to the initiation of macro-cracks caused by the accumulation of damage generated by actual service loads for the case of bridges. In what follows, consideration is given to developing fatigue crack growth criterion based on the concept of the continuum damage mechanics (CDM). Fatigue accumulative is included in the model where a fatigue limit for multi-axial stress state is considered. The proposed criterion advocates the evolution of micro-crack growth up to the stage of macro-crack formulation. Considered are the loading histories that correspond to normal traffic loading for highways and railways, incidental or accident loadings such as those caused by typhoons and effective environmental loadings. The potential sites of damage are determined are discussed. The proposed criterion is applied to analyze the fatigue damage of the Tsing Ma Bridge with online strain history data acquired by the SHM system that is permanently installed in the bridge.  相似文献
